What Safe Maintenance Tasks You Can Handle As a Weekend DIY Project

A routine garage door repair vs self-service decision often favors the homeowner for basic preventative upkeep that does not involve tensioned components. Safe DIY tasks include wiping down steel tracks with a damp cloth, tightening loose track bracket bolts with a socket wrench, and applying a silicone-based lubricant to the hinges, rollers, and bearing plates. You can also test your auto-reverse safety features monthly by placing a roll of paper towels in the path of the closing door. The Dangers of High-Tension Springs and Cable Adjustments

Garage door repair vs DIY intervention becomes an extreme safety hazard the moment torsion springs or lift cables enter the equation. A torsion spring operates under immense torque, balancing hundreds of pounds of dead weight; if a winding cone slips or a rusted spring snaps during an unexperienced DIY attempt, the resulting steel recoil can cause catastrophic injury. Even cable drum adjustments require precise tension balancing on both sides of the door to prevent binding. If your door is crooked, refusing to open, or making loud popping noises, skip the guesswork. Navigating Brickmould, Jamb, and Masonry Garage Frame Integrity

A masonry garage repair vs standard wood framing fix requires specialized masonry bits, concrete anchors, and damp-proofing materials to withstand Torrance’s coastal humidity and morning marine layers. Older detached and attached garages in the South Bay often feature exterior brick facades that anchor the wooden jambs directly to masonry piers. Over time, ground settling and moisture intrusion can rot the timber framing hidden behind the brickwork or cause the brickmould to crumble around the weatherstripping. Attempting to lag-bolt a new heavy-duty garage door track into compromised masonry without proper masonry anchors will cause the fasteners to strip and pull out under operational vibration. Frequently Asked Questions

Why is my older Torrance garage door jamming when the coastal morning fog rolls in?

Coastal humidity and temperature drops cause older wooden frames and uninsulated steel tracks to expand and contract, binding the rollers against weathered brickmould and rusted jambs. If lubrication does not fix the bind, professional track realignment is required.

Can I replace a snapped torsion spring myself in my Torrance garage?

No, replacing a torsion spring yourself is extremely dangerous due to the high torque stored in the metal coil, which can slip and cause severe injury; always rely on certified technicians with proper winding bars.

What are the warning signs that my garage door framing in Old Torrance is failing?

Cracked exterior masonry around the jamb, gaps between the brickwork and the steel track brackets, and doors that rub unevenly against the header are clear signs of structural framing shift that need professional reinforcement.

How often should Torrance homeowners inspect their garage door tracks and masonry seals?

We recommend checking your tracks, weatherstripping, and brickmould seals at least twice a year—ideally during seasonal transitions—to catch minor shifting and moisture damage before it leads to a costly emergency breakdown.
